@ The Happy Knot - 'Taker's been in the WWF/E since before WrestleMania 7. His WM debut was a win over an old and out-of-shape Jimmy "Superfly" Snuka in 1991. This match is the ending of a feud the two had after Jake wanted to attack Miss Elizabeth after her "wedding" to Randy "Macho Man" Savage at SummerSlam '91. Roberts was hiding behind a curtain with a chair ready to strike Liz as she was walking back to the locker room, and Taker took the chair away.
